E2open makes second acquisition in less than a year, bringing Logistyx Technologies into the fold
March 7, 2022
Austin, Texas-based E2open, a network-based provider of cloud-based, mission-critical, end-to-end supply chain management platform services, saying it has bought Rolling Meadows, Ill.-based Logistyx Technologies, a provider of global parcel and e-commerce shipping and fulfillment technology services, for $185 million.

Körber to acquire Siemens Logistics’ mail and parcel business for €1.15 billion
February 10, 2022
With around 1,200 employees, Siemens Logistics mail and parcel business generates annual revenue of about €500 million.

OneRail closes $9M series A investment round, bringing total raise to $21.5M
September 2, 2021
Orlando-based OneRail, a provider of final mile delivery services for enterprise shippers via a delivery fulfillment SaaS platform, recently announced it closed a $9 million Series A investment, bringing its total capital raise, to date, to $21.5 million.

New ShipMatrix USPS parcel offering provides retail and e-commerce options with peak season options
November 9, 2020
Entitled the ShipMatrix 1st Class Parcel Service, the firm said that this offering is geared towards retail and e-commerce shippers that have been “capped” by the parcel duopoly of FedEx and UPS for the 2020 peak season. Some of the key aspects of this offering, according to ShipMatrix, include: no limit on parcel volume; no peak season surcharges; and an automatic money-back guarantee on packages that are not delivered within five days.

ShipStation research looks at consumer shipping expectations amid COVID-19 pandemic
October 15, 2020
Some of the main takeaways of the report, entitled “Last Touch, Lasting Impact: The 2020-2021 Edition,” which was based on survey results from more than 1,400 e-commerce customers across North America, noted how North American consumers indicated they have increased online shopping by 33% over the last year, with around two-thirds saying the majority of their shopping is handled online, due to the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ic.
